Form 4: Celsius Holdings Director's Call Options Expire Unexercised

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


A director of Celsius Holdings, Dean DeSantis, had call options on 150,000 shares expire unexercised, as they were out of the money.

Summary

  • Dean DeSantis, a director at Celsius Holdings, had call options on 150,000 shares of common stock expire without being exercised.
  • These call options were sold by CD Financial LLC, where Mr. DeSantis is a trustee, to an unaffiliated third party on July 12, 2023.
  • The call options were out of the money on their respective expiration dates and therefore were not exercised.
  • The options expired on January 21, 2025, January 22, 2025 and January 23, 2025, with 50,000 shares covered by each option.
